'Revolutionary Conversation', Trenton Free Public Library
Trenton Free Public Library will transform into a "living museum" featuring students from Sprout U School of the Arts sharing the perspectives of African Americans on the Revolutionary War and its meaning for enslaved people during a free community event. Join us to hear stories of African Americans living during the Revolutionary War -- as continental soldiers, loyalists, slaves and citizens -- and discuss how our community can interpret our shared history in ways that respect our shared ideals of equality.
